About This Webinar
Tax season can feel intimidating — especially for independent retailers managing inventory, payroll, vendor payments, and fluctuating cash flow.
In this session, we break down tax preparation into manageable, practical steps so retailers can approach filing season with clarity rather than stress.
This webinar focuses on:
What documents to gather
Key deadlines to track
Common retail-specific tax considerations
How to work effectively with your accountant
The goal is not to provide tax advice, but to equip retailers with an organized checklist that simplifies preparation and prevents last-minute scrambling.
